Sir Michael Caine has claimed that his favourite artist Lincoln Townley could be the 'next Andy Warhol' after he sold out the world-renowned La Biennale in Venice.
The legendary actor, 91, has collected several pieces of art painted by some of the world's most sought-after artists including David Hockney, 86, who famously designed menus for the restaurant he once owned.
However, the Italian Job star has supported and become a firm favourite of Lincoln Townley - who is married to Denise Welch - over the last 10 years as he has been regularly painted by him.
When talking about Lincoln's exhibition at the world-renowned La Biennale in Venice, Michael exclusively revealed to MailOnline: 'Lincoln Townley calls me his muse and that’s a title I’m happy to have, every piece he paints seems to become more powerful,
'I have followed Lincoln’s career for over ten years and I have watched him grow and develop as a world-class artist. I was so pleased to hear that he sold out his show,

'I like to think of it that he arrived at the palazzo in Italy for the Venice Biennale and blew the bloody doors off!'
Lincoln first painted Michael and his wife Shakira Caine in 2016, and after he presented them with the painting, Lincoln revealed Michael proudly said: 'There's no doubt in my opinion that Lincoln is the next Andy Warhol.'
He added: 'I have always looked at greed as a very positive energy. In the case of my sell-out show at the Venice Biennale, it’s all about power consuming power, the savage god that my buyers worship,
'It’s the god we see only when we have the courage and the honesty to look beyond good and evil, to suspend our judgment and see our ravenous species for what it is.
'My collectors see themselves in my work, they hang these oil works with pride and celebrate the fact that they push boundaries to secure 100 per cent of the deals they are working on within their financial world. There is glory in greed and glory can only be acquired through risk.'
The self-taught painter is set to host another art exhibition later this year, and MailOnline can exclusively reveal the exhibition will feature paintings of Michael to pay homage to the Hollywood actor's incredible career.
It comes after the London-born artists' biggest show to date was unveiled last month at the Palazzo Bembo Hotel in Venice.
The exhibition features a collection of 24 abstract figurative oil paintings which explore the controversial obsession with money, power and greed and focus on the world of bankers.

The unique show will run for eight months and the works will be ‘refreshed’ every two and half months.
Meaning that collectors who have already bought the paintings will get the opportunity to see the works exhibited.
Lincoln is one of the UK's most successful modern artists and his work currently sells for in excess of £1million.
Aside from Michael, he has also been commissioned to paint several other icons including Charlie Sheen, Al Pacino, Kate Moss, Princess Diana, David Bowie, and Leonardo DiCaprio.
